Understanding Disabled Scooters

Disabled scooters are motorized vehicles designed to assist people with mobility problems. They are especially helpful for those who have problem utilizing manual wheelchairs or strolling help. These scooters are available in numerous sizes and designs, catering to various requirements and preferences. They are geared up with features such as comfortable seating, adjustable speed settings, and safety systems to ensure a smooth and protected trip.

Advantages of Disabled Scooters

  1. Improved Independence: One of the main advantages of utilizing a disabled scooter is the increased independence it provides. Users can take a trip to numerous locations without counting on others, which enhances their confidence and self-esteem.
  2. Enhanced Mobility: Scooters allow people to cover longer distances with less effort, making it simpler to take part in social activities, run errands, and delight in outside spaces.
  3. Comfort and Safety: Modern scooters are developed with ergonomic seats, adjustable backrests, and other convenience features. They likewise consist of safety functions such as brakes, lights, and turn signals to make sure a safe riding experience.
  4. Cost-efficient: Compared to other mobility aids like power wheelchairs, scooters are typically more cost effective and need less maintenance.

Kinds Of Disabled Scooters

  1. Three-Wheeled Scooters: These scooters are understood for their dexterity and maneuverability. They are perfect for indoor use and narrow areas but might not be as steady as four-wheeled models.
  2. Four-Wheeled Scooters: Offering better stability and balance, four-wheeled scooters appropriate for both indoor and outdoor usage. They are particularly useful for users who require to browse unequal terrain.
  3. Portable Scooters: Designed for travel, these scooters can be taken apart and carried in a vehicle or on public transport. They are light-weight and simple to store.
  4. Heavy-Duty Scooters: Built for users who require a higher weight capability, durable scooters mobility for sale are robust and resilient. They are ideal for individuals who require additional assistance and stability.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: Are disabled scooters covered by insurance coverage?A: Some insurance strategies, consisting of Medicare, may cover the cost of a disabled scooter if it is deemed clinically required. It's important to talk to your insurance coverage service provider to comprehend the protection information and any required paperwork.

Q: How do I maintain my disabled scooter?A: Regular upkeep is essential to guarantee the longevity and safety of your scooter. This includes inspecting the battery, tires, and brakes routinely, keeping the scooter clean, and following the manufacturer's maintenance standards.

Q: Can I use a disabled scooter on public transportation?A: Many public transportation systems, consisting of buses and trains, are geared up to accommodate disabled scooters. However, it's advisable to check the specific policies and requirements of the transportation service provider in your location.

Q: What is the average life expectancy of a disabled scooters near me scooter?A: With correct maintenance, a disabled scooter can last for several years. The typical life expectancy is generally around 5-10 years, depending upon use and care.

Q: Can I drive a disabled scooter on the road?A: In most places, disabled scooters are enabled on roads, but they need to stick to particular policies. It's crucial to inspect regional traffic laws and standards to guarantee safe and legal usage.
